Output e396f998d81609ef1fbb56e68e285fa59db3d3aaec5ddc9d37a34be27655bfed:0

value
22532
script pubkey
OP_0 OP_PUSHBYTES_20 de4d6d41d2c1217c9076be945bdaa5428f643f3f
address
bc1qmexk6swjcysheyrkh629hk49g28kg0elkp4z60
transaction
e396f998d81609ef1fbb56e68e285fa59db3d3aaec5ddc9d37a34be27655bfed
confirmations
59933
spent
true